Tourist Attractions in Thekkady
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ary
Whether you an adventure enthusiast or wildlife lover, a visit to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ary is must if you travel to Thekkady Kerala. Covering 777 sq km of landscaped area,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ary provides habitat to an incredible species of flora and fauna. A boat-ride over the glistening waters of the Periyar Lake offers a rewarding bird watching experience.
Watchtowers (Wildlife Sanctuary)
Edappalayam, Manakkavala and Thannikudi are three watchtowers from where you can see animals in their natural habitat.
Kumily
Plan an excursion to Kumily if you travel to Thekkady. This charming plantation town is only 4 km away from Thekkady and is one of the most important spice trade hub and shopping center.
Pandikuzhi
5 km away from Kumily, Pandikuzhi is a perfect picnic site where you can unwind yourself. Here you can immerse yourself nature photography and trekking.
Mangala Devi Temple
Amidst lush greenery atop a peak, Mangala Devi Temple is 15 km away from Thekkady. Have a glimpse into the traditional Kerala architecture. One can only visit the temple on the Chithra Pournami festival.
Pullumedu
This hill town is about 43 km away from Thekkady. Feel the bliss and serenity as you drive your way to Pullumedu. See a velvety carpet of nature that adds to the beauty of the town. One needs to obtain permission from the Wildlife Preservation Officer to visit Pullumedu.
